烬 is pronounced jìn in Mandarin Chinese. It means Ashes or cinders.
纸变成了灰烬。
zhǐ biàn chéng le huī jìn
The paper turned into ashes.
火堆里还有余烬。
huǒ duī lǐ hái yǒu yú jìn
There are still embers in the bonfire.
房子化为灰烬。
fáng zi huà wéi huī jìn
The house was reduced to ashes.
